Question 1: If I currently run an athlon 700 with an asus k7m mb, if I'm trying to upgrade my mb and chip to the ecs k7s5a pro and 1800xp, can i just move over my harddrive without reinstalling anything. (Wondering if there are any bios and cmos issues stored on the harddrive)

Question 2: On the Ecs board, there seems to be no 3 prong setup for the Power Led jumpers. They have PWR-SW which i set up. and there is a mention of FP PWR/SLP (MSG LED dual color or single color) but it only allows for two spots where as the provided PWR-SW from my antec box needs three spots, one being a dummy.

The harddrive does not store BIOS information, but Windows might freak out from all the new hardware. I usually do a clean install prior to changing something like a motherboard. It's possible for it to work without a format, but it's a good idea to slick the drive before installing the mb.

You may have to get a replacement connector for your power led if it is 3 pin and the ECS only supports 2. Directron sells them.

most cases come with a 3 pin power led connector but ECS only has 2 pins. :confused:


Here's what I did when this happened to me,fist find yourself a small needle,then lift up the small tab on the end cable on your 3 pin connector & lift it free.


Now you have a 3 pin connector with 1 wire & one free wire,just connect those 2 & it will work fine,if it doesnt light up just reverse the wires on the 2 pin mobo connection. :)
